Can gas dissolved in gas to form a solution explain with an example?

If the solvent is a gas, only gases are dissolved under a given set of conditions. An example of a gaseous solution is air (oxygen and other gases dissolved in nitrogen). Since interactions between molecules play almost no role, dilute gases form rather trivial solutions.

Is air a gaseous solution?

The air is a natural gas-gas solution. Air is made up primarily of nitrogen (~78%) and oxygen (~21%) with trace amounts of argon, carbon dioxide and water vapour.

How do you get rid of dissolved gases in a liquid?

You can completely rid a liquid of any dissolved gases (including unwanted ones such as Cl 2 or H 2 S) by boiling it in an open container. This is quite different from the behavior of most (but not all) solutions of solid or liquid solutes in liquid solvents.
